Can GeForce RTX 3060 run Cyber Clutch: Hot Import Nights?
GreatThe GeForce RTX 3060 handles Cyber Clutch: Hot Import Nights well at 1080p, delivering approximately 266 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 199 FPS.
Cyber Clutch: Hot Import Nights – GeForce RTX 3060 F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 415 fps | 312 fps | 166 fps |
| Medium | 332 fps | 249 fps | 133 fps |
| High | 266 fps | 199 fps | 106 fps |
| Ultra | 216 fps | 162 fps | 86 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

About
Cyber Clutch: Hot Import Nights, released in 2025, is an exhilarating fusion of action, indie, and racing genres set in a vibrant, neon-infused future. Players engage in high-intensity arcade combat racing, where they not only compete in ranked online matches but also leverage tactical abilities to outmaneuver their opponents. The chaotic circuits and customizable rides make each race a unique experience, drawing in fans of adrenaline-pumping gameplay.
